Detailed Solution

Given, xn=xn+12 

 x1=x22,x2=x32,,xn=xn+12

On multiplying x1=xn+1(2)nxn+1=x1(2)n

Hence,     xn=x1(2)n1

Area of Sn=xn2=x122n1<1

 2n1>x12 x1=10

 2n1>100

But, 27>100,28>100 etc.

 n1=7,8,9,n=8,9,10,
